North Mississippi Health Services is seeking a Radiology Technologist for a job in Verona, Mississippi.
Job Description & Requirements\n JOB SUMMARY
\n
\nThe Technologist II-Radiology at North Mississippi Health Services plays a crucial role in performing various technical procedures requiring independent judgment and applying ionizing radiation. They also contribute to budget control by minimizing supply use and overtime. This position acts as a liaison between staff, physicians, patients, and family members, ensuring effective communication and interaction within the Radiology department.
